禁用行为底部导航栏在颤动中随键盘一起弹出的方法取决于你使用的是哪种开发框架或技术。以下是一些常见的方法:
position: fixed
属性来固定底部导航栏的位置,使其不受键盘弹出的影响。具体的CSS代码如下:.navbar {
position: fixed;
bottom: 0;
left: 0;
width: 100%;
}
这样设置后,底部导航栏将始终固定在屏幕底部,无论键盘是否弹出。
window.addEventListener('resize', function() {
var navbar = document.querySelector('.navbar');
if (window.innerHeight < window.outerHeight) {
navbar.style.display = 'none';
} else {
navbar.style.display = 'block';
}
});
这段代码会在窗口大小改变时触发resize事件,并根据窗口的内部高度和外部高度来判断键盘是否弹出,从而控制底部导航栏的显示与隐藏。
总结起来,禁用行为底部导航栏在颤动中随键盘一起弹出的方法主要包括使用CSS属性固定导航栏位置、使用JavaScript监听事件来控制导航栏的显示与隐藏,以及使用特定的前端框架或库提供的解决方案。具体选择哪种方法取决于你的项目需求和技术栈。
没有搜到相关的沙龙
领取专属 10元无门槛券
手把手带您无忧上云